- Jon On Nov 18, 2006, at 11:56 AM, Rey Bango wrote: > Hi Rick, > > Firebug is a Firefox addon that dramatically helps your Javascript > development efforts. It helps you debug the code, inspect DOM > values and > even view HTTP requests (critical for Ajax development).
